Internal linking is one of the most powerful, underused on-page SEO techniques. Done right, it improves rankings, keeps users on your site longer, and helps search engines understand and index your content more efficiently.
What Are Internal Links?
Internal links are hyperlinks that connect one page on your website to another page on the same domain. They can appear in navigation menus, footers, sidebars, and within the body content of your pages. Internal links help both users and search engines discover more of your content and understand how your pages relate to each other.

Why Internal Links Matter for SEO
Internal links distribute authority (often called “link equity”) across your site, helping important pages rank better. They also give search engines context about what each page is about through surrounding content and anchor text. For users, good internal linking creates natural “paths” through your site, increasing session duration, page views, and conversions.
Internal Linking Best Practices
Use Keyword-Rich Anchor Text
Anchor text is the clickable text of a link, and it should clearly describe the page you’re linking to. Use your target keyword or a close variation in the anchor text so search engines can understand the topic of the destination page. Keep it natural and readable—avoid stuffing the exact keyword everywhere, and mix in synonyms and related phrases.
Link To AND From Your Important Pages
Identify your “money” or key pages (services, product pages, pillar blogs, category hubs) and make sure:
- Many relevant pages link to them with descriptive anchor text.
- Those key pages also link out to closely related supporting content.
This two-way linking reinforces their importance in your site structure and makes it easier for users and crawlers to reach them.
Don’t Use the Same Anchor Text for Two Different Pages

If two different pages both receive links with the same anchor text, search engines can get confused about which page should rank for that term. Give each important page a clear primary keyword and keep its main anchor text variations unique. If two pages compete for the same phrase, consolidate or differentiate their focus instead of splitting signals.
Audit Your Internal Links Regularly
Over time, pages get removed, URLs change, and new content is added—your internal link structure naturally drifts. Run regular audits (monthly or quarterly on active sites) to:
- Fix broken or redirected internal links.
- Add links to new content from relevant older posts.
- Remove irrelevant or redundant links that add noise.
A quick audit keeps crawl paths clean and ensures link equity flows to the right places.
Put Links High Up on Your Page
Links placed higher in the content tend to be crawled and clicked more often. Where it makes sense, add key internal links within the introduction or early sections of your content. This helps users discover important pages sooner and signals to search engines that those destinations are especially relevant.
Keep People on Your Pages Longer
Strategic internal linking encourages users to explore related articles, category hubs, and offers, increasing time on site and pages per session. Longer, more engaged sessions are strong quality signals and also give you more opportunities to convert visitors. Think of internal links as “next step suggestions” that guide users deeper into your funnel.
Use “Dofollow” Links
Internal links should almost always be standard (follow) links so that authority can pass through them. Using “nofollow” internally blocks link equity and makes it harder for search engines to understand which pages are important. Only consider “nofollow” for truly unimportant or utility pages you don’t want indexed (and even then, usually robots rules are better).
Use Internal Links to Help with Indexing
Search engines discover new content primarily by following links. Whenever you publish a new page, link to it from:
- A relevant existing article or hub page.
- Category pages or sitemaps where applicable.
This reduces the chance of “orphan pages” (pages with no internal links) and helps new content get crawled and indexed faster.
Link Strategically From Your Homepage
Your homepage is often the most authoritative URL on your site, so links from it are especially powerful. Use it to highlight key categories, cornerstone guides, top products, and high-value landing pages—not every random blog post. Keep the homepage navigation and featured sections focused on pages that drive business or support your core topics.
Avoid Automation
Automated internal linking plugins or scripts that add links based purely on keywords can create spammy, irrelevant links. They often:
- Overuse the same anchor text.
- Link to pages that don’t truly match the context.
- Place too many links per page.
Manual or semi-manual linking, guided by editorial judgment, produces far better SEO and UX outcomes.
Add Internal Links to Old Pages
Every time new content goes live, look for opportunities in older, related posts to link to it. This does two things: passes existing authority from strong older pages and creates fresh user paths to your new page. Periodic “content refresh” sessions where you update old posts and add new links can deliver noticeable ranking gains.
Don’t Go Overboard
Too many links on a single page overwhelm users and dilute the value of each link. While there’s no fixed “right number,” aim for:
- Only contextually relevant links that actually help the reader.
- A balance where links are spread naturally through the content, not crammed into every sentence.
If a page looks cluttered with blue text, you likely need to cut back.
Consider First Link Priority
When multiple links on a page point to the same URL, search engines commonly give more weight to the first occurrence’s anchor text. Place your most descriptive, keyword-rich anchor text for a given target page earlier in the content. Later navigational or generic anchors (like “click here”) will still work for users but carry less SEO importance.
Final Thoughts
Internal linking is a foundational SEO strategy that strengthens website architecture, enhances user experience, and improves search engine crawlability. By connecting relevant pages with descriptive, keyword-rich anchor text, you guide both visitors and search engines through your content ecosystem. Strategic internal linking distributes page authority, establishes topic clusters, and ensures important pages receive prominence in your site hierarchy. Regular audits help identify broken links, orphan pages, and opportunities to connect new content with existing resources. Ultimately, thoughtful internal linking balances SEO objectives with user navigation needs, creating a cohesive digital experience that drives engagement and rankings.